WebApr 10, 2024 · Crypto Tax India Key Points: Profits from the sale, swap or spend of any crypto assets are taxed at a rate of 30% (plus surcharge as applicable and 4% cess). Profits are taxed under section 115BBH. Lower tax on long-term capital gains is not available. No deduction, except the cost of acquisition, is allowed.
